Evaluation of Mixed-Mode Fracture (KI & KII) in Epoxy using AECS Configuration
Abstract
Mixed-mode fracture tests are conducted on Asymmetric Edge Cracked Semi-circular (AECS) bend specimens made of Epoxy Resin material. AECS specimens are exposed to 3-point bend asymmetric loading. The crack parameter stress intensity factor (SIF) for different support locations and crack lengths is obtained using ANSYS. By selecting suitable locations for the load points, complete mode mixes (mode I to II) can be attained. A sequence of fracture experiments are carried out and results were obtained on proposed specimens made of epoxy and a very decent agreement was achieved among the experimental results and the predicted results.
